93-hr-16788 93 hr 16788 A bill to reduce pollution which is caused by litter composed of soft drink and beer containers, and to eliminate the threat to the Nation's health, safety, and welfare which is caused by such litter by banning such containers when they are sold in interstate commerce on a no-deposit, no-return basis. Environmental Protection 1974-09-23 1974-09-23 Referred to House Committee on Interstate and Foreign Commerce. House Rep. Fish, Hamilton, Jr. [R-NY-25] NY R F000141 0 Prohibits the manufacture, sale, or delivery for sale of beverage containers with respect to which no reasonable refund money deposit is required from the consumer for use in marketing or packaging any beverage for human consumption. 2024-08-01T18:38:43Z
